Output 7cc280ff5aff8a47fe11e2f32e50c206f457b515cf045138b86187cdbab3016a:11

value
19960213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46d89edf859d0313230aa25151e72c07d594aa9a OP_EQUAL
address
389cj2ygTvfPyybUjVkPgWXMC5z5sURVo3
transaction
7cc280ff5aff8a47fe11e2f32e50c206f457b515cf045138b86187cdbab3016a
confirmations
339239
spent
true